Beauty and terror are sometimes close together.

Description

In Lantsch/Latsch, for example, the beauty unfolds directly in the village with its richly painted house-hugging. Some paintings are by Hans Ardüser, a travelling painter who moved through Graubünden around 1600.

On the other hand, the avalanches that fall from the Lenzerhorn and the neighbouring Piz Linard down the valley at Lantsch/Lenz are always a source of terror. In Val Meltger, a steep ravine above Lantsch/Lenz, avalanches have already torn down a wooden bridge several times. In 2005, a suspension bridge was built that leads over the Val Meltger at a height of 12 meters. The bridge creates a safe path over the Tobel – and enables a beautiful circular hike from Lantsch/Lenz, which can also be undertaken as a snowshoe tour in winter.
